Commercial Slab Installation in Fredericksburg, VA

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ete slabs that serve as foundational surfaces for various types of structures, such as warehouses, retail spaces, garages, and outdoor patios. This service covers projects that require durable, level, and stable concrete bases designed to support heavy equipment, foot traffic, or other structural loads.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the installation process, the materials used, and how the finished slab will meet the specific needs of their project, ensuring proper planning and long-term performance.

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ners should consider factors such as the size and design of the slab, the soil conditions of the site, and any necessary permits or regulations. It’s also helpful to clarify whether the project involves additional features like reinforcement, drainage considerations, or surface finishes. Having a clear understanding of these aspects can help ensure the project aligns with the intended use and provides a solid foundation for future development or operational needs.

FAQ

Commercial Slab Installation Questions

What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or work areas on commercial properties.

What materials are used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the standard material for commercial slabs, often reinforced with steel for added strength and durability.

How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ness of a commercial slab depends on its intended use, typically ranging from 4 to 12 inches, based on load requirements.

What preparations are needed before slab installation? Site clearing, proper grading, and soil compaction are essential steps to ensure a stable base for the slab.
